                I had a couple of struggles that for example were connected to how Contabo operates. For example I installed the wrong version of cloudron, then cancelled the process, than I had to reinstall the whole Ubuntu and then I had trouble to reconnect to the server due to some ssh key or such. So it's not related to cloudron. There is one thing I suggest that's worth fixing on cloudron side, though:

                I restored cloudron with a config file. That went all in all pretty smooth. The form that showed up after uploading the config file did miss one information. Google Buckets require some sort of json key. But the form did not show in red what was missing. So I suggest to have a negative validation (e.g. in red) for missing elements. At that moment I did not even know that such json key exists because it's a while ago that I connected a google cloud bucket to cloudron.

                          • jdaviescoatesJ jdaviescoates

                            @why42 said in AVX Support in your VPS/Server:

                            So could you please provide Cloudron versions >=7.6 without AVX/AVX2 dependencies.

                            I don't think that is going to happen tbh.

                            The problem is the MongoDB 5 which numerous apps require itselfs requires AVX/AVX2

                            Sadly that means the the cheap Netcup VPS servers are no longer compatible with Cloudron (although their more expensive RS RootServer range still is).

                            I'd recommend checking out Hetzner Cloud as an almost as cheap but overall imho much better provider than Netcup (tbh I've just found everything about Netcup to be clunky, whereas the whole experience with Hetzner is pretty great imho)
